This event is part mystery, part history lesson, and part treasure hunt. “We’ With gemological credentials earned in New York, London, and the University of Nantes in France, Gregory E. Sherman is one of the most highly qualified gemologists and jewelry appraisers in the United States. He is a 23-year jewelry industry professional with extensive experience in retail management, consulting, gemological research, jewelry appraising, teaching, and training. He has discussed jewelry topics on the radio and appeared on the History Channel’s Diamond Mines and on Shop NBC as a gemstone expert. He is coauthor of the booklet Changing the Color of Diamonds, the High Pressure High Temperature Process Explained, and has written numerous articles for the jewelry trade. Sherman has taught gemology at the Fashion Institute of Technology in Manhattan and at the California Institute of Jewelry Training, and is an authorized instructor for the Gemological Association of Great Britain. A highlight of Sherman’s career was appraising a 108 carat D color Flawless diamond worth over 25 million dollars. Limit one jewelry item per person on a first come first serve basis. Founded in 1973, Fred Meyer Jewelers is the nation’s third-largest fine jewelry retailer operating nearly 400 jewelry stores in 36 states under the Fred Meyer Jewelers and Littman Jewelers brand names. The stores carry a broad assortment of engagement and wedding rings, fine jewelry for women and men, and brand-name watches. Fred Meyer Jewelers, Inc. is a wholly owned subsidiary of Fred Meyer Stores, Inc., which was acquired in 1999 by The Kroger Co. , one of the nation's largest grocery retailers.
